Out Of The Money Call Option on Molson Coors
An 'Out of The Money' option on Molson has a strike price that Molson Stock has yet to reach, meaning the option has no intrinsic value. 'Out of The Money' options are usually less costly than 'In The Money' options, making them more desirable to traders with smaller amounts of capital. Some of the uses for Molson Coors' 'Out of The Money' options include buying the options if you expect a big move in Molson Coors' stock. Since 'Out of The Money' options have a lower up-front cost (i.e., no intrinsic value) than 'In The Money' options, buying it is a reasonable choice.

Molson long PUT Option Payoff at expiration
Put options written on Molson Coors grant holders of the option the right to sell a specified amount of Molson Coors at a specified price within a specified time frame. The put buyer has a limited loss and, while not fully unlimited gains, as the price of Molson Stock cannot fall below zero, the put buyer does gain as the price drops. So, purchasing a put option on Molson Coors is like buying insurance aginst Molson Coors' downside shift.
